Do you enjoy looking at all the houses decorated for Christmas? I will drive around towns just to find houses that are all lit up. This past week I was driven to a street in Holliston and I loved it! Every house on the cul-de-sac had Christmas decorations. Most houses had wooden cut outs lit up. These included m&m's, the Disney gang, Charlie Brown and the gang, minions and so many more.
